Ingredients You’ll Need
- Fresh Strawberries: About 2 cups, quartered. These juicy berries add natural sweetness and color.
- Blueberries: 1 cup. A burst of flavor and antioxidant-rich, they’re perfect for spring.
- Vanilla Yogurt: 2 cups. This adds creaminess and enhances texture.
- Honey: 1/4 cup. A natural sweetener that complements the fruits beautifully.
- Graham Cracker Crumbs: 1 1/2 cups. For the crust, these add a pleasant crunch.
- Unsalted Butter: 1/2 cup, melted. It’s essential for binding the crust.
- Mint Leaves: A handful, chopped. The mint offers a fresh aroma and vibrant flavor.
- Lemon Juice: 2 tablespoons. A touch of acidity balances the sweetness of desserts.
How to Make
-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ures that your crust bakes evenly and becomes golden brown.
- In a medium b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s and melted butter. Mix well until the crumbs are fully moistened. This will be the base for your crust. Press this mixture into the bottom of a 9-inch pie dish to form an even layer, creating a solid foundation for the creamy filling.
- Bake the crust in the preheated oven for about 10 minutes, or until it is golden brown and fragrant. Allow it to cool while preparing the filling. This step is crucial as it prevents a soggy bottom and enhances flavor.
- In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the vanilla yogurt, honey, and lemon juice until smooth. Taste the mixture to adjust sweetness if necessary. The yogurt provides a creamy texture that is refreshing and light.
- Once the crust has cooled, pour the yogurt mixture into the crust and spread it evenly. Gently press the strawberries and blueberries into the yogurt filling, making sure they are evenly distributed. This visually stunning dessert will have layers of color and texture.
- Chill the dessert in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, allowing it to set properly. This also helps meld the flavors together, making each bite refreshing and packed with fruit flavor. Serve chilled for the best experience, and enjoy the burst of freshness!
Variations & Substitutions
Berry Bliss Variation: Instead of just strawberries and blueberries, try using raspberries or blackberries for a mixed berry delight. This adds different textures and flavors, enhancing the overall dessert experience. Each berry brings its unique sweetness and tartness, which can create a more complex flavor profile that sings of spring.
Chocolate Lovers Variation: For a richer dessert, layer chocolate pudding under the yogurt filling. This adds a decadent touch, turning your light dessert into a chocolate dream. The creamy chocolate contrasts beautifully with the fresh fruits, providing a delightful balance between sweet and tangy.
Vegan Adaptation: Substitute the yogurt with a high-quality plant-based yogurt and use agave syrup instead of honey. This makes the dessert fully vegan-friendly while keeping the same creamy texture and refreshing taste. The plant-based adaptations still deliver flavor without sacrificing texture.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Creating desserts can sometimes lead to unexpected challenges. Here are some common pitfalls to avoid when making your spring delights:
Soggy Crust Issues: One major mistake is not baking the crust long enough, which can result in a soggy base. Always ensure your crust is golden and firm before adding any fillings. If you find your crust is too wet, consider adding more graham cracker crumbs or reducing the liquid ingredients in your filling.
Overmixing the Filling: When combining ingredients, overmixing can create a watery filling. Mix just until combined to maintain a thicker consistency, which will ensure a tempting, well-set dessert.
Fruit Placement: Avoid placing the fruit on the bottom of the crust. Instead, ensure they are layered throughout the filling. This allows for even distribution of flavor, as well as a beautiful presentation when sliced. If located solely at the bottom, the fruit may sink during chilling.
Storage, Freezing & Reheating Tips
To ensure your spring dessert remains fresh, store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It can last up to 3 days. The flavors will actually continue to develop, making it even tastier the day after preparation. Freezing is not recommended for this dessert because the texture of the yogurt can become grainy once thawed.
When preparing for gatherings, you can make the crust and yogurt filling a day in advance, assembling the dessert just before serving. This way, it provides a delightful centerpiece for your spring table.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use frozen fruits instead of fresh ones? Yes, but be sure to thaw and drain them first. Frozen fruits can release excess water, which may affect the consistency of the yogurt filling. Pat them dry after thawing to help maintain the right texture. If using frozen berries, aim to add them right before serving to prevent them from becoming mushy.
Is it possible to make this dessert gluten-free? Absolutely! Use gluten-free graham crackers for the crust, ensuring your dessert caters to those with gluten sensitivities. Many natural food stores carry excellent gluten-free options that maintain the same crunch and flavor as traditional graham crackers.
What’s the best way to serve this dessert? This dessert shines when served chilled. To enhance presentation, consider garnishing with additional mint leaves or a light dusting of powdered sugar. Portion it into individual servings for a beautiful buffet display, allowing guests to enjoy a taste of spring in every bite.
How can I add a tangy flavor to the yogurt? A splash of fresh lime juice or zest can add just the right touch of tartness. This can enhance the overall flavor profile and give your dessert an appealing zing that complements the sweetness of the fruits.
Are there any other fruits that work well in this recipe? Definitely! Peaches, nectarines, or even citrus segments like mandarin orange can be delightful additions. Each fruit brings a different flavor, making this dessert versatile and endlessly adaptable. Consider seasonal availability to keep things fresh!
